History of
B-17 42-39794

42-39794Delivered Long Beach 3/9/43; Assigned 358BS/303BG [VK-F] Molesworth 18/10/43; {10m} Missing in Action Oschersleben 11/1/44 with Bill Dashiell, Co-pilot: Hilton Mabie, Navigator: Tom Sutherland, Bombardier: George Fee, Flight engineer/top turret gunner: Bob Stevenson, Radio Operator: Bernie Radebaugh, Ball turret gunner: Art Robinson, Waist gunner: Bob Parker, Waist gunner: Bob Owen,Tail gunner: Cliff McKinney (10 Killed in Action); enemy aircraft, crashed Nollman Farm, Hagen-Natrup, six miles SW of Oschersleben, Ger. Missing Air Crew Report 1929.
